Transaction e6766b587583500578583e59085e5ca6f2666f8c81d754fc44526deb9c3dbaaa
1 Input
1 Output
-
e6766b587583500578583e59085e5ca6f2666f8c81d754fc44526deb9c3dbaaa:0
- value
- 332043
- script pubkey
- OP_0 OP_PUSHBYTES_20 0343e80c697b348fba57512a6ec3d55194caddc3
- address
- bc1qqdp7srrf0v6glwjh2y4xas742x2v4hwr2hag3e